Popular dessert recalled over fears of glass shards
A well-known dessert brand has issued a recall due to the potential presence of glass in an ingredient.
The recall is on the 600g Nanna’s Family Apple Pie with a best before date of October 21, 2020 or October 22, 2020 only.
The NSW Food Authority advises that it is the result of an equipment failure with the supplier.
No other Nanna’s products are part of the recall.
The supplier, Patties Foods Ltd, is recalling the product from Woolworths, Coles, IGA, Foodland and other independent supermarkets nationally as a precautionary measure.
Anyone who has purchased the recalled product should return it to the place of purchase for a full refund.
